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4797 8763157 44329
19625 19471 3801710
19625 19471 3801710
6600596 10944881 749769 714
All about undefined
Interested in learning more?
19625 19471 3801710
6600596 10944881 749769 714
See more
56047736220 6333310 274
51709 8484 38618683123 86
See more
58 8770953
1991496 34306144 790 84
See more